Function

GRXC5_ARATH Has a glutathione-disulfide oxidoreductase activity in the presence of NADPH and glutathione reductase. Reduces low molecular weight disulfides and proteins. Can assemble a [2Fe-2S] cluster, but cannot transfer it to an apoferredoxin.[1]
